OTTAWA, ON, May 15, 2026 /CNW/ - The Honourable Heath MacDonald, Minister of Agriculture and Agri-Food, will travel to Saskatchewan on May 19 and 20 to visit key agricultural research and processing sites, consult with stakeholders, and meet with government and industry leaders.
Day 1 – Saskatoon, Saskatchewan:
- Minister MacDonald will spend time at the University of Saskatchewan and visit the Western College of Veterinary Medicine and VIDO (Vaccine and Infectious Diseases Organization).
- He will take part in stakeholder consultations and will take part in a site visit at K+S Potash.
Day 2 – Regina, Saskatchewan:
- Minister MacDonald will attend and participate in the Cargill Regina Canola Processing Facility Ribbon-Cutting Ceremony & Celebration. Please contact Sara_Ragaller@cargill.com for details.
- He will also meet with his provincial counterpart, David Marit, and hold stakeholder consultations.
This is Minister MacDonald's third visit to Saskatchewan.
